How is plaster of Paris prepared ? Why is plaster of Paris stored in an airtight container ?

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

### Step-by-Step Solution: **Step 1: Preparation of Plaster of Paris** - Plaster of Paris is prepared by heating gypsum (CaSO4·2H2O) at a temperature of about 373 Kelvin (approximately 100°C). - The chemical reaction that occurs is as follows: \[ \text{CaSO}_4 \cdot 2\text{H}_2\text{O} \xrightarrow{\text{heat}} \text{CaSO}_4 \cdot \frac{1}{2}\text{H}_2\text{O} + \text{H}_2\text{O (vapor)} \] ...
